#64f4c2 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#64f4c2 is composed of 39.2% red, 95.7% green and 76.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 59% cyan, 0% magenta, 20.5% yellow and 4.3% black. It has a hue angle of 159.2 degrees, a saturation of 86.7% and a lightness of 67.5%. #64f4c2 color hex could be obtained by blending #c8ffff with #00e985. Closest websafe color is: #66ffcc.

#64f4c2 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#64f4c2 has RGB values of R:100, G:244, B:194 and CMYK values of C:0.59, M:0, Y:0.2, K:0.04. Its decimal value is 6616258.
